What are Phonics Printables?
Learning to read is one of the most significant milestones in a child's educational journey. It opens doors to a world of knowledge, imagination, and communication. For many parents and educators, finding the right tools to teach reading skills can be a challenge. This is where phonics printables come into play. Phonics printables are educational resources designed to help children learn and practice phonics, a method of teaching reading by correlating sounds with letters or groups of letters.
Phonics printables are versatile and can be used in various settings, from homeschooling to traditional classrooms. They come in a variety of formats, including worksheets, flashcards, and activity sheets, making them suitable for different learning styles and ages. These resources are carefully crafted to introduce children to the basics of phonics, such as recognizing letter sounds, blending sounds to form words, and segmenting words into individual sounds.
